*BEIJING: *A white paper released by the State Council Information Officein China has revealed that Muslims are the biggest minority ethnic group inthe country.
China has over 20 million Muslims, more than 57,000 clerical personnel, and35,000 Islamic mosques, according to the white paper released on Tuesday.
In total, the country has nearly 200 million religious believers and morethan 380,000 clerical personnel, the paper outlined. The major religionspracticed in China are Buddhism, Taoism, Islam, Catholicism, andProtestantism, said the document.
According to the document, there are around 222,000 Buddhist clericalpersonnel and over 40,000 Taoist clerical personnel.
The 10 minority ethnic groups, the majority of whose population believe inIslam, total significantly more than 20 million, with about 57,000 clericalpersonnel, said the document.
Catholicism and Protestantism have 6 million and 38 million followers inChina, respectively, with 8,000 and 57,000 clerical personnel, said thewhite paper.
There are approximately 5,500 religious groups in China, including sevennational organizations which are Buddhist Association of China, ChineseTaoist Association, China Islamic Association, Chinese Catholic PatrioticAssociation, Bishops’ Conference of Catholic Church in China, NationalCommittee of the Three-Self Patriotic Movement of the Protestant Churchesin China, and China Christian Council.
“Conditions of places of worship have been notably improved,” claims thedocument.
At present, there are about 144,000 places of worship registered forreligious activities in China, among which are 33,500 Buddhist temples(including 28,000 Han Buddhist temples, 3,800 Tibetan Buddhist lamaseries,and 1,700 Theravada Buddhist temples), 9,000 Taoist temples, 35,000 Islamicmosques, 6,000 Catholic churches and places of assembly spread across 98dioceses, and 60,000 Protestant churches and places of assembly, it said. -APP
